Figure 7
Phenotype of DgPAPS4 transgenic plants, and the expression levels of genes involved in the vernalization pathway. A, Morphological phenotypes of DgPAPS4 transgenic plants and Col-0 wild-type plants after 4 weeks vernalization treatment and then 21 d growth under long-day conditions. “WT” indicates the wild type (Col-0), and “OE” indicates the transgenic line. Scale bar, 2 cm. B, Flowering time of DgPAPS4 transgenic plants and Col-0 wild-type grown under long-day conditions after vernalization (Data are means ± SD, n = 10, Wilcoxon test, **P<0.01). C, Expression of AtAGL20 with different vernalization treatments in transgenic and wild-type plants; NV, non-vernalization; V4W, vernalization treatment for 4 weeks. Error bars indicate the standard error of three biological replicates (Wilcoxon test, **P<0.01). D, DNA methylation levels of promoter regions of AtAGL20. McrBC-qPCR analysis was performed in WT and transgenic plants after vernalization. Methylated DNA can be digested by McrBC, thus higher qPCR signals indicate lower methylation levels. Error bars indicate the standard error of three biological replicates (Wilcoxon test, *P<0.05; **P<0.01).
